Polybutylene Terephthalate (PBT) is a highly valued engineering thermoplastic known for its excellent mechanical properties, electrical insulation, and chemical resistance. However, for many applications, particularly in the electronics and automotive sectors, enhancing its flame retardancy is a critical requirement. Aluminum Diethylphosphinate (CAS 225789-38-8) is an ideal additive for PBT, providing a superior alternative to traditional flame retardants. Its primary advantage lies in its halogen-free composition, which translates to significantly reduced smoke generation and non-toxicity during combustion. This is crucial for applications where occupant safety and environmental impact are major considerations. When incorporating Aluminum Diethylphosphinate into PBT formulations, manufacturers can expect exceptional flame retardant performance. This chemical is known for its ability to achieve UL94 V-0 ratings, even in thin sections, which is a critical benchmark for many electronic components and automotive parts. The efficiency of this flame retardant allows for its use at moderate levels, thereby preserving the inherent desirable properties of PBT, such as its excellent dimensional stability, good electrical insulation, and resistance to heat and moisture.
The thermal stability of Aluminum Diethylphosphinate is another key factor making it suitable for PBT processing, which typically occurs at temperatures around 230-250°C. Our product maintains its integrity and effectiveness throughout these high processing temperatures, ensuring consistent flame retardant performance in the final product. Furthermore, compounds formulated with this additive often demonstrate good aging resistance, which is vital for applications requiring long-term durability and reliability.
